President Trump’s cancellation of tariffs today is stirring significant discussion, particularly in the crypto space. While some people remain hopeful about this move, stark contradictions arise as concerns about its actual impact surface.

The Tariff Cancellation's Importance

The cancellation could lead to a $150 billion cash influx into the market, but experts express skepticism. A comment from a forum highlights concerns that refunds won’t appear immediately, stating, "the government will probably have to do tax credit for the companies affected and spread it out over the year instead of a one-time lump sum." Moreover, another user remarked, "There is no refund," stressing doubts over the feasibility of outright refunds.

Sentiments Among Analysts

Reactions on various forums delve into both cautious optimism and critical skepticism:

  • Skepticism on Refunds: With doubts about the government’s ability to provide immediate refunds, analysts caution that the fluidity of cash remains uncertain. A forum user bluntly said, "It's all a scam; the corporations will get a big check, and that’s it."

  • Market Viability: Some analysts question whether this move will help cryptocurrencies directly. A user mentioned, "Should this not do the opposite? Money will go back into the markets rather than to speculative currency."

  • Potential Downturn: Another contributor pointed to a bleak outlook, arguing, "Crypto is dead for the next 4 years. 2026 was the start of the downfall," reflecting a stark belief in market decline rather than growth.

"The government doesn't have this cash sitting around," noted a commenter, highlighting the realities behind anticipated liquidity.
